Paulikan Tarihi hakkindaki genel kabul goren yorumu yeniden degerlendirme dusuncesi bana ilk kez Profesor Austin P. Evans tarafindan Columbia Universitesi’nde ortacag heretikleri uzerine yapilan bir seminerde bizzat kendisi tarafindan dile getirilmisti. Konu hakkinda calisan diger arastirmacilarin da karsi karsiya kaldigi temel problemle kisa surede ben de yuzlesmek zorunda kalmistim. Bu problem Yunan ve Ermeni kaynaklarinin yarattigi celiskili ikili yapi ve Ermeni kaynaklarinin onerdigi sekliyle Paulikanizm’in gnostik-dualist bir tarikat goruntusuyle uyum icinde olmayisi yuzunden ortaya cikmaktadir. Elinizdeki calismada ana hedef Paulikanizm’in kokenleri, dogasi ve tarihcesi uzerine mevcut kaynaklarin tumunun yeniden degerlendirilmesi olarak belirlenmistir. Dogasi geregi boylesi bir calismanin kesinlik icermeyen ve parcalar halinde bir yapida olmasi ve kuskusuz eldeki kanitlarin da yetersizligi degerlendirildiginde mevcut problemlerin bazilari icin kesin kenarlari olan bir cozum uretilememis olmasi normal karsilanmalidir. Bu calismadaki temel amac Paulikanizm’in Ermenistan, Firat havzasi ve (Constantinople) Istanbul’daki erken donem gelisimi hakkindaki mevcut bilgiyi bir araya getirmektir.
